• English
  • Русский
Главная/Новостной блог/
Что такое смарт-контракты и как они работают:...

Что такое смарт-контракты и как они работают: простое объяснение — ASCN

Что такое смарт-контракты и как они работают: простое объяснение — ASCN
20/08/2025

Что такое смарт-контракты и как они работают: простое объяснение — ASCN

Слышали ли вы когда-нибудь о сделках без посредников? Без юристов, нотариусов, доверенностей? Это уже не фантастика, а вполне реальная технология, которая меняет финансовый и правовой мир - смарт-контракты. Они обещают прозрачность, автоматизацию и, самое главное, доверие в цифровом пространстве.

Понятие смарт-контракта: простыми словами

Чтобы понять, как всё это устроено, начнем с самого начала. Без терминов, только суть.

Определение и суть

Смарт-контракт - это программа, которая автоматически выполняет условия договора, заложенные в её код. Никаких “если” и “а вдруг”, всё строго по алгоритму. Если заданы условия.

Например, представьте: вы арендуете онлайн-хранилище. В коде смарт-контракта прописано: если пользователь оплатил 0.01 ETH, система выдает доступ. Не оплатил - нет доступа.  Такая система работает на блокчейне - распределенной базе данных, где каждое действие фиксируется навсегда и не может быть подделано.

Кто придумал идею смарт-контрактов

Хотя кажется, что это что-то новое, идея появилась ещё в 1994 году. Её автор - Ник Сабо, американский криптограф и юрист, который задолго до биткоина предложил концепцию цифровых соглашений, исполняемых автоматически.

Ник Сабо также считается возможным создателем биткоина (хотя это не доказано). Его идея о “смартконтрактах” легла в основу многих современных блокчейн-систем, включая Ethereum.

Но реализовать всё это стало возможно только с приходом блокчейнов второго поколения, в частности, Ethereum в 2015 году. Именно тогда идея стала рабочей технологией.

Как они отличаются от обычных контрактов

Классический контракт - это бумага, где прописаны обязательства сторон. Чтобы он начал работать, его должны исполнять люди. А если кто-то нарушит условия? Понадобятся суды, юристы и месяцы ожидания.

Умный контракт, наоборот, сам проверяет выполнение условий и сам применяет последствия. Без возможности вмешательства извне. 

Как работают смарт-контракты

Теперь, когда основа понятна, давайте копнем чуть глубже. Что же заставляет эти “цифровые контракты” работать так надёжно?

Блокчейн и децентрализация

Смарт-контракты не висят где-то на сервере компании. Они размещаются прямо в блокчейне, где информация хранится на тысячах компьютеров по всему миру.

Это значит, что изменить или удалить контракт - невозможно. Никто не может “передумать”, стереть запись или отменить выполнение. К тому же, блокчейн защищён от взломов благодаря принципам криптографии и консенсуса.

Например, вы создали contract, который переводит средства создателю NFT после успешной продажи. Этот код будет работать одинаково и в Японии, и в Аргентине. Потому что он живёт не на локальном сайте, а в сети, где нет центрального управляющего узла.

Языки программирования (Solidity, Rust и др.)

А теперь немного о том, из чего всё это сделано. Чтобы создать smartcontract, разработчики используют специальные языки программирования. Самые популярные:

• Solidity - основной язык для Ethereum. Напоминает JavaScript, но заточен под работу в блокчейне.

• Rust - используется в проектах типа Solana и Near. Даёт высокий уровень безопасности и производительности.

• Vyper - альтернатива Solidity, сделан проще и безопаснее.

Принцип «если – то» (if/then logic)

В основе каждого smart-contract лежит логика условий: если выполнено условие - совершается действие. Очень похоже на Excel-формулы, но на стероидах. 
Для примера возьмем покупку NFT.
Если пользователь отправил ровно 1 ETH, тогда ему автоматически передаётся NFT. И всё - без человеческого участия. 

Примеры в Ethereum и других сетях

Ethereum - лидер в мире smart contract. На нём работают:

• Uniswap - децентрализованный обменник токенов.

• Aave - платформа для кредитования без банков.

• OpenSea - крупнейший рынок NFT.

Но и не только Ethereum:

• Solana - высокая скорость, низкие комиссии.

• BNB Chain - доступен для массового применения.

• Polkadot - ориентирован на совместимость между блокчейнами.

Эти сети предлагают разные плюсы, но суть одна: код исполняется сам, без посредников.

Где применяются смарт-контракты

Теперь, когда вы знаете, как работает эта система, самое время перейти к главному вопросу: где всё это действительно используется? И вот тут начинается самое интересное. Смарт-контракты не просто теоретическая фишка для разработчиков. Уже сегодня они лежат в основе десятков реальных сервисов и платформ.

DeFi-протоколы (обменники, лендинг, стейкинг)

DeFi - это децентрализованные финансы. В отличие от привычных банков, здесь всё работает через код и блокчейн, а не через сотрудников в галстуках.

Вот где особенно мощно раскрывается потенциал smart contracts:

• Обменники (DEX) - такие как Uniswap, Raydium, PancakeSwap. Вы подключаете кошелёк, выбираете токены, а затем обменик мгновенно проводит своп по текущему курсу, фиксируя это в блокчейне. 

• Лендинг - например, Aave или Compound. Хотите взять криптовалюту в долг? Смарт-контракт блокирует ваш залог и автоматически выдаёт займ. Погасили - получите залог обратно. 

• Стейкинг - как в Lido или RocketPool. Вы передаёте свои токены в контракт, а он “застейканные” средства направляет в сеть и распределяет вознаграждение обратно.

По состоянию на 2025 год, в DeFi заблокировано более 130 млрд долларов. И с каждым годом это число растет.

NFT и игровые проекты

NFT взорвали рынок цифрового искусства и коллекционирования. Но по сути - это токены, которые существуют благодаря smart-контрактам.

Вот как это выглядит:

• Вы создаёте NFT - смарт-контракт записывает в блокчейн, кто владелец и какие у него права.

• Продажа NFT - контракт автоматически переводит токен новому владельцу и распределяет комиссию (например, 10% художнику).

• Игры используют контракты для управления внутриигровыми активами, боями, лутом и наградами.

Благодаря им, цифровые предметы становятся настоящими активами, которыми можно владеть, продавать и обменивать.

ICO, DAO и краудфандинг

Вспомните, как работает обычный краудфандинг: вы отправляете деньги, а дальше надеетесь, что проект всё выполнит. Надежда - сомнительная гарантия.

Смарт-контракты убирают этот риск:

• В ICO инвесторы получают токены только если условия соблюдены.

• В DAO решения принимаются через голосование, а результат - технрлогией.

• В краудфандинге средства могут высвобождаться поэтапно, после достижения целей - без ручного контроля.

Например, проект собрал 500 ETH на разработку игры. Контракт выпускает токены инвесторам, а средства становятся доступны команде лишь после подтверждения этапов разработки.

Идентификация, логистика, страхование

Сюрприз - смарт-контракты применяются не только в финансах и криптовалютах.

• Идентификация: проекты создают децентрализованные ID, которые контролируются только пользователем. Смарт-контракты управляют доступом и верификацией.

• Логистика: внедряются блокчейн-решения, где каждый этап перемещения груза фиксируется контрактом - без бумажной путаницы и фальсификаций.

• Страхование: сервисы предлагают полисы, где выплаты автоматически происходят при наступлении застрахованного события (например, задержки рейса).

Преимущества и риски использования смарт-контрактов

Да, всё звучит очень круто. Автоматизация, блокчейн, децентрализация… Но давайте не будем идеализировать. Как и любая технология, смарт-контракты - это и возможности, и угрозы.

Прозрачность, безопасность, автоматизация

Начнём с хорошего. Вот почему умные контракты завоёвывают мир:

• Прозрачность - код контракта обычно открыт. Вы можете сами прочитать, что именно произойдёт с вашими деньгами.

• Безопасность - контракты живут в блокчейне, и никто не может их изменить задним числом. Даже разработчик.

• Автоматизация - всё работает по заданным правилам. Человеческий фактор исключён.

Ошибки в коде и взломы

Теперь о неприятном. Смарт-контракт - это всё-таки код, а код могут писать… люди. А люди ошибаются. В жизни такие случаи уже бывали тира DAO Hack в 2016 году на сумму 50 млн $ или Poly Network Hack в 2021 году с суммой более 600 млн долларов.

Важно понимать. Если контракт написан с ошибкой - исправить его невозможно. Деньги могут “застрять”, быть утеряны или украдены. Именно поэтому сегодня существует направление аудита смарт-контрактов.

Юридические и технические ограничения

И ещё кое-что важное. Смарт-контракты не заменяют законы. Они работают только внутри блокчейна. За его пределами могут возникнуть проблемы:

• Что делать, если код работает, но был взломан?

• А если участник сделки несовершеннолетний?

• Как доказать суду, что вы не нарушали условий контракта?

Во многих странах до сих пор не существует полноценного правового статуса смарт-контрактов. Есть рекомендации, но нет единого закона.

Будущее смарт-контрактов и тренды 2025 года

Мы подошли к тому, где технология находится прямо сейчас  и это уже впечатляет. Но что дальше? 2025 год - это время, когда появляются новые подходы, меняющие правила игры.

Смарт-контракты 2.0

Первое поколение контрактов было простым: “если получил оплату - выдай услугу”. Сейчас на сцену выходят умные контракты второго уровня. Они способны:

• взаимодействовать с внешними источниками данных;

• учитывать изменение состояния за пределами блокчейна;

• быть модульными.

Чтобы было понятнее, вот пример: контракт для страхования урожая учитывает не только факт оплаты, но и погодные данные в регионе, уровень влажности и даже спутниковые снимки.

Смарт-контракты 2.0 становятся более гибкими. Появляются обновляемые контракты, которые можно модернизировать без потери функционала.

Кроссчейн-решения и интерактивные контракты

Ограниченность одним блокчейном - прошлый век. Сегодня всё больше проектов работают сразу на нескольких сетях (Ethereum, Solana, Avalanche, Arbitrum, zkSync и т.д.).

Кроссчейн-смарт-контракты позволяют:

• передавать данные и токены между сетями;

• выполнять сложные логики, охватывающие несколько блокчейнов;

• избегать высокой комиссии в перегруженных сетях.

Развиваются протоколы вроде LayerZero, Axelar - они связывают смарт-контракты между собой, создавая по-настоящему глобальную архитектуру Web3.

А ещё - интерактивные контракты. Это когда логика контракта может адаптироваться в реальном времени. Представьте себе DAO, которое может менять внутренние параметры голосования на основе поведения участников.

AI + Smart Contracts

Звучит как научная фантастика, но уже реальность. Искусственный интеллект и смарт-контракты начинают работать в тандеме. Уже сейчас GPT-подобные модели обучаются на Solidity и помогают писать коды, генерируют предложения по коду контракта, путем анализа успешных шаблонов 

Конечно, это ещё “сырая” область, но рост потрясающий. Многие криптостартапы в 2025 уже используют AI-ассистентов для генерации логики контрактов и анализа кода на уязвимости.

Регулирование и правовой статус

И наконец - закон. Успех любой технологии зависит от того, как её принимает общество и государства. В Европе, США и Aзии сейчас активно разрабатываются и внедряются регулирования смарт-контрактов.

Но правовая база всё ещё отстаёт. Законы не успевают за технологиями. Поэтому пока важно понимать: юридическая сила смарт-контрактов всё ещё ограничена, особенно в трансграничных ситуациях.

Заключение: стоит ли изучать смарт-контракты

На этом этапе уместен один простой вопрос: а нужно ли вам разбираться в этой теме? Ответ - зависит от того, кто вы.

Для разработчиков

Если вы разработчик, особенно с опытом в вебе, backend или мобильной разработке - учить создание smart contract просто необходимо. Это новая ступень в ИТ, где вы не просто пишете код, а программируете экономику.

Изучите Solidity или Rust. Попробуйте развернуть собственный контракт в тестовой сети. Освойте аудит безопасности. Сейчас, в 2025 году, специалисты по блокчейн-разработке востребованы как никогда и получают соответствующую оплату.

Для инвесторов

Вы вкладываете в DeFi, ICO или NFT-проекты? Тогда знание основ smart contract - это не просто полезно, а жизненно необходимо.

Читая код или хотя бы понимая, какой функционал скрыт за кнопкой “инвестировать”, вы минимизируете риски. А они, как мы уже выяснили, далеко не иллюзорные.

Научитесь пользоваться обозревателями блокчейна (например, Etherscan). Смотрите, какие именно контракты взаимодействуют с вашими средствами и проверяйте наличие аудита.

Для пользователей Web3

Если вы обычный пользователь Web3 - покупаете NFT, стейкаете токены, участвуете в DAO, то понимание смарт-контрактов сделает вас в разы увереннее.

Вы перестанете просто «тыкать кнопки», а начнёте осознанно взаимодействовать с системой. Поймёте, как именно работает взаимодействие с вашим кошельком. И, возможно, однажды напишете собственный, который перевернёт правила игры.

Кстати, если после этой статьи у вас остались вопросы - это нормально.
Поэтому и существует ASCN.ai - крипто-ИИ, который говорит с вами на одном языке. Без перегрузки терминами, но с точной экспертизой. Хотите узнать, как работает конкретный DeFi-протокол, проверить проект перед инвестированием или разобраться, что там в коде смарт-контракта? Помимо этого он может стать вашим личным инвестиционным помощников в выборе стратегий или анализе рынка.

Попробуйте - он уже ждёт вас.

Главная/Новостной блог/
Что такое смарт-контракты и как они работают:...

Подпишитесь на нас в соцсетях: